Analysis

In 2023, deaths and missing persons due to natural disasters in Guatemala stood at 1.6.

That represents a change of up 105.1% on the previous year and up 213.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, deaths and missing persons due to natural disasters in Guatemala peaked at 28.56 in 2020 and was at its lowest, 0, in 2006.

Guatemala ranks 49th of 135 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
